India women's hockey team's winning run at the ongoing Tokyo 2020 Olympic Games came to a halt on Wednesday. While Gurjit Kaur yet again had given India the lead early in the match by converting a penalty corner, Argentina did manage to equalise in the second quarter as their captain Noel Barrionuevo scored the equaliser. Barrionuevo scored again in the third quarter to put Argentina in the lead and although the Indian team fought hard in the final few minutes to level the scores, eventually it was Argentina that held their nerves to book a place for themselves in the final.

Argentina will now be up against the Netherlands in the gold medal match while all is not lost for the Indian team as they will have to buckle and play Great Britain in the bronze medal match on Friday.

Earlier, the women's team beat three-time champions Australia in their quarterfinal match to reach their first-ever semis in the history of the Olympic games. After taking the lead in the 22nd minute, India were spot on with their defence work, denying the opponents even a single goal. It was also the first time Australia conceded through a penalty corner at the ongoing Games which suggests the magnitude of India's achievement by reaching so far.

The Rani Rampal-led side will now look to give their best to come back with a bronze, which will be no less than the biggest of achievements, given the grit and fight the women have shown at the Olympics this year.
